Legal experts say if everything isn't in order you could have problems in future
Recently divorced parents have been issued a warning to make sure everything is in order as their children head back to school. For divorcees with children, the beginning of a new academic year involves legal considerations which, if not properly addressed, can lead to conflicts and legal issues further down the line.
Approximately 3.18million UK families are headed by a single parent, according to recent data. With divorces historically spiking in August following the summer holidays, Jennifer Moore, Legal Director at Rayden Solicitors who are experts in child arrangements orders has shared the legal considerations newly separated must make as their child embarks on the new school year.
Responsibilities for school-related decisions must be clearly outlined to avoid disputes over pick-up and drop-off schedules, alongside participation in any school events. If these are not set in place, and large changes are made informally, progressing with these changes without the proper legal documentation may render them unenforceable if a conflict arises.Typically, both parents will possess the right to view their child's educational records, irrespective of custody agreements.
Any outdated or inaccurate information could lead to delays in urgent situations, whilst disagreements regarding medical decisions could result in further legal complications.It’s important to align the financial responsibilities of each parent where the child’s education is concerned, not only to ensure that your child’s needs are adequately addressed.
Clarify who will handle costs for school supplies, uniforms, extracurricular activities, and any additional requirements set forth by the school. Disagreements over unforeseen expenses can develop into legal disputes, so it’s essential to tackle these matters proactively within your custody and financial arrangements.
